For the 2026-27 school year, there are 2 public middle schools serving 45 students in Ulm Elementary School District. This district's average middle testing ranking is 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public middle schools in Montana.
Public Middle Schools in Ulm Elementary School District have an average math proficiency score of 43% (versus the Montana public middle school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 25% (versus the 47%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 4%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the Montana public middle school average of 23% (majority American Indian).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$12,386 in this school district is less than the state median of $15,507. The school district revenue/student has grown by 37%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$12,956 is less than the state median of $15,598. The school district spending/student has grown by 38% over four school years.
